First off I am asking about ALL in EV, which is the best measure I have for how "lucky/unlucky" I am running. So, for all that say I play bad - thanks for the thoughts.
Secondly, I wanted to know what is the high end of extreme variance - is it being 10 buy ins below expectation over 5000 hands, 100 buy ins below EV over 50 000 hands. What is the high end of normal mathematical variance is all I am asking.

No. First, it's Chebyshev's inequality. Second, it relates to a sample from a distribution such that 1/n^2 of the distribution is within n std deviations from the mean, nothing in it refers to being within 2sds fot he mean. Perhaps you're thinking of a normal distribution. Third, you need to know the mean and standard deviation...and the whole point of this thread is asking what is a reasonable standard deviation.
